How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Duffy?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Duffy Studio Apartments | $792 | $599 | $1,529 |
Duffy 1 Bedroom Apartments | $903 | $651 | $1,932 |
| Duffy 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,202 | $625 | $2,141 |
| Duffy 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,550 | $925 | $3,451 |
| Duffy 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,800 | $1,800 | $1,800 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Duffy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Duffy with 1 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Duffy is at Riverstone listed at $651.
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Duffy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Duffy is $903.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Duffy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Duffy is a 850 square feet unit starting from $985 at Del Rey Apartments.
What is the average size for Duffy 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Duffy is currently 640 sq ft.
